Java开发者薪资最低?程序员只能干到30岁?国外真的没有996?Intellij真的比Eclipse受欢迎?△Hollis,一个对Coding有着独特追求的人△这是Hollis的第230篇原创分享作者lHollis来源lHollis(ID:hollischuang)StackOverflow作为全球最大的程序设计领域的问答网站,每年都会出据一份开发者调查报告。前段时间,StackOverflow
分类:
编程语言 时间:
2020-11-01 09:22:19
阅读次数:
19
原创|Java13明天发布,最新最全新特性解读△Hollis,一个对Coding有着独特追求的人△这是Hollis的第229篇原创分享作者lHollis来源lHollis(ID:hollischuang)2017年8月,JCP执行委员会提出将Java的发布频率改为每六个月一次,新的发布周期严格遵循时间点,将在每年的3月份和9月份发布。目前,JDK官网上已经可以看到JDK13的进展,最新版的JDK1
分类:
编程语言 时间:
2020-11-01 09:21:51
阅读次数:
19
写在前面 本文参考以下文章,请参考原文 Spring Cloud 从入门到精通 Spring Cloud Zuul中使用Swagger汇总API接口文档 待解决问题 在微服务架构中,Swagger为各个微服务生成的API文档都都离散在各个微服务中,不方便查看,我们希望将这些接口都整合到一个文档中。那 ...
分类:
编程语言 时间:
2020-11-01 09:20:42
阅读次数:
20
<!-- web --> <d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-web</artifactId> </dependency> <!-- MySQL 连接驱动依赖 ...
分类:
编程语言 时间:
2020-11-01 09:18:18
阅读次数:
18
你知道的越多,你不知道的越多前言自学/学习路线这样的一期我想写很久了,因为一直想写的全一点硬核一点所以拖到了现在,我相信这一期对不管是还在学校还是已经工作的同学都有所帮助,不管是前端还是后端我都墙裂建议大家看完,因为这样会让你对你所工作的互联网领域相关技术栈有个初步的了解。你们也知道敖丙我是个创作鬼才,常规的切入点也不是我的风格,我毕业后主要接触的都是电商领域,所以这一期我把目前所了解的技术栈加上
分类:
编程语言 时间:
2020-10-31 02:49:11
阅读次数:
89
你知道的越多,你不知道的越多前言自学/学习路线这样的一期我想写很久了,因为一直想写的全一点硬核一点所以拖到了现在,我相信这一期对不管是还在学校还是已经工作的同学都有所帮助,不管是前端还是后端我都墙裂建议大家看完,因为这样会让你对你所工作的互联网领域相关技术栈有个初步的了解。你们也知道敖丙我是个创作鬼才,常规的切入点也不是我的风格,我毕业后主要接触的都是电商领域,所以这一期我把目前所了解的技术栈加上
分类:
编程语言 时间:
2020-10-31 02:48:50
阅读次数:
83
开场白张三最近天气很热心情不是很好,所以他决定出去面试跟面试官聊聊天排解一下,结果刚投递简历就有人约了面试。我丢,什么情况怎么刚投递出去就有人约我面试了?诶。。。真烦啊,哥已经不在江湖这么久了,江湖还是有哥的传说,我还是这么抢手的么?太烦恼了,帅无罪。暗自窃喜的张三来到了某东现场面试的办公室,我丢,这面试官?不是吧,这满是划痕的Mac,这发量,难道就是传说中的架构师?张三的心态一下子就崩了,出来第
分类:
编程语言 时间:
2020-10-31 02:42:32
阅读次数:
22
Java中的事务——全局事务与本地事务在上一篇文章中说到过,Java事务的类型有三种:JDBC事务、JTA(JavaTransactionAPI)事务、容器事务。这是从事务的实现角度区分的,本文从另外一个角度来再次区分一下Java中的事务。站在事务管理的角度,可以把Java中用到的事务分为本地事务和全局事务。本地事务不用事务的编程框架来管理事务,直接使用资源管理器来控制事务。典型的就是java.s
分类:
编程语言 时间:
2020-10-31 02:42:04
阅读次数:
25
?上篇《Java线程的6种状态详解及创建线程的4种方式》前言:我们都知道,线程是稀有资源,系统频繁创建会很大程度上影响服务器的使用效率,如果不加以限制,很容易就会把服务器资源耗尽。所以,我们可以通过创建线程池来管理这些线程,提升对线程的使用率。1、什么是线程池?简而言之,线程池就是管理线程的一个容器,有任务需要处理时,会相继判断核心线程数是否还有空闲、线程池中的任务队列是否已满、是否超过线程池大小
分类:
编程语言 时间:
2020-10-31 02:40:27
阅读次数:
25
1. Ribbon 负载均衡框架,支持可插拔式的负载均衡规则 支持多种协议,如HTTP、UDP等 提供负载均衡客户端 1.1 负载均衡器组件 一个负载均衡器,至少提供以下功能: 要维护各个服务器的IP等信息 根据特定逻辑选取服务器 为了实现基本的负载均衡功能,Ribbon的负载均衡器有三大子模块: ...
分类:
编程语言 时间:
2020-10-31 02:39:42
阅读次数:
30
463. 岛屿的周长 给定一个包含 0 和 1 的二维网格地图,其中 1 表示陆地 0 表示水域。 网格中的格子水平和垂直方向相连(对角线方向不相连)。整个网格被水完全包围,但其中恰好有一个岛屿(或者说,一个或多个表示陆地的格子相连组成的岛屿)。 岛屿中没有“湖”(“湖” 指水域在岛屿内部且不和岛屿 ...
分类:
编程语言 时间:
2020-10-31 02:37:48
阅读次数:
20
题意: 题面 分析: 在上届银牌学姐的帮助下 我们发现对于一个连通块若 \(m\) 个约束条件里共有 \(n\) 个点,那么答案一定是 \(n\) 或者 \(n-1\) 因为最多 \(n\) 条有向边可以将一个连通块变成一个强连通分量,而至少 \(n-1\) 条边才能保证 \(n\) 个点是联通的, ...
分类:
编程语言 时间:
2020-10-31 02:34:52
阅读次数:
14
1.编程语言分类 分类: 机器语言 汇编语言 高级语言(编译型、解释型) 总结: 执行效率:机器语言>汇编语言>编译型语言>解释型语言 开发效率:机器语言<汇编语言<编译型语言<解释型语言 跨平台性:解释型语言具有极强的跨平台性 2.Python解释器安装 官网Download 界面下载2.7及3. ...
分类:
编程语言 时间:
2020-10-31 02:33:31
阅读次数:
17
上机目标 使用OO的思想封装代码 使用比较器(内部和外部比较器)完成OO的比较排序 学会使用Lambda表达式 Java API的随机数生成、集合类的使用 Java String的应用初探 分别实现 基于成绩(数值类型)的比较及统计: (1) 请按照成绩进行排序(升序或者降序),排序之后,按照分数段 ...
分类:
编程语言 时间:
2020-10-31 02:30:48
阅读次数:
19
Season.java package class00; public enum Season { SPRING,SUMMER,FALL,WINTER } TestZero.java package class00; import java.io.File; import java.io.FileN ...
分类:
编程语言 时间:
2020-10-31 02:26:05
阅读次数:
18
前面介绍了zk指令的使用,这里说一下java客户端中怎么使用这些指令 <dependency> <groupId>org.apache.zookeeper</groupId> <artifactId>zookeeper</artifactId> <version>3.5.5</version> </ ...
分类:
编程语言 时间:
2020-10-31 02:20:05
阅读次数:
13
图说:为什么Java中的字符串被定义为不可变的全文字数:1200阅读时间:3分钟8张图,看懂Java字符串的不变性字符串,想必大家最熟悉不过了,通常我们在代码中有几种方式可以创建字符串,比如:Strings="Hollis";这时,其实会在堆内存中创建一个字符串对象,其中保存了一个字符数组,该数组中保存了字符串的内容。上面的箭头可以理解为“存储他的引用”。当我们在代码中连续创建
分类:
编程语言 时间:
2020-10-31 02:18:58
阅读次数:
16